The problem here is that the NFD is a favorite here and even a hand like he showed up with has quite a bit of equity versus us.

We also are deep and need to call another 102 big blinds. I feel that this is a very high variance spot and one in which we may not show a huge profit in the long term so I'd prefer a bet/fold (without reads/history).

As a side note I can't really expect villain to shove many 66-99 hands.
